## Onboarding — Markdown Pipeline (Inkmere)

Inkmere docs render through a three-stage pipeline: parse, sanitize, emit. Releases rebuild all templates; never hot-patch emitted HTML. Broken renders usually mean a sanitizer rule change — check the rules diff first. The render cluster only accepts builds from the release channel, and every build artifact must be signed before upload. Sign artifacts with the deploy key below.

release key, hafop-tajef: bky13_s2vaFVNJTHfBL

MEMO — Kettling Depot Receiving

Uniform sets for the new Kettling depot arrive Wednesday via Ashgrove courier: 40 boxes, sorted by size, manifest attached to box one. Check the count at the dock before signing; shortages go straight to stores, not the courier. The hand-over instruction the courier will follow is set out below.

drop instructions, tafof-baguf: the holmir gilox courier leaves the sormir ulaok holdor ledger at gate 5596 under passcode 257343

**FAQ: What if Nightloom's backfill scheduler loses its state store?**

Nightloom, the scheduler driving our nightly data backfills, keeps run history in an encrypted state store. If the store becomes corrupted or the scheduler host is rebuilt, backfills will not resume automatically — this came up twice last quarter, hence the agenda item for the weekly eng sync. Recovery is straightforward: restore the latest snapshot, then re-initialize the store. The init command prompts for the recovery passphrase provided below.

unlock words, hahip-baduf: holwyn-istath-julvan

Build provenance: Digest Scheduler (Lanternmail). Every deploy of the batch email digest scheduler is built in the sealed pipeline and signed before promotion; unsigned artifacts must never be rolled out, even during an incident. When paged for digest delays, first confirm the running artifact matches the attested release record. The currently attested provenance token is recorded below.

trace token, bagug-yahof: htk21_2d0de668956bdbfbe66bf